Trade Union (Wales) Act 2017

JurisdictionWales
Citation2017 anaw 4
(1) The Trade Union and Labour Relations (Consolidation) Act 1992 (c.52) (as amended by the Trade Union Act 2016 (c.15) ) is amended as follows.(2) In section 116B (restriction on deduction of union subscriptions from wages in public sector) , after subsection (3) insert—
  • “(3A) But regulations under subsection (3) may not specify—
  • (a) a devolved Welsh authority, or
  • (b) a description of public authority that applies to a devolved Welsh authority.
a devolved Welsh authority, ora description of public authority that applies to a devolved Welsh authority.(3) In section 172A (publication requirements in relation to facility time) , after subsection (2) insert—
  • “(2A) But regulations under subsection (1) may not specify—
  • (a) a devolved Welsh authority, or
  • (b) a description of public authority that applies to a devolved Welsh authority.
a devolved Welsh authority, ora description of public authority that applies to a devolved Welsh authority.(4) In section 226 (requirement of ballot before action by trade union) , after subsection (2E) insert—
  • “(2EA) But regulations under subsection (2D) may not specify services provided by a devolved Welsh authority.
But regulations under subsection (2D) may not specify services provided by a devolved Welsh authority.(5) After section 297A insert—
    (297B) Devolved Welsh authoritiesFor the purposes of this Act a “devolved Welsh authority” has the same meaning as in section 157A of the Government of Wales Act 2006 (c.32) .
